Stress of Competition

Stress in the field of esports isn’t to be taken lightly. I might not be a player myself…in fact, I don’t understand half of what’s going on, but I wasn’t hired for my ability to game. I basically just hover around, asking the pros if they’re doing okay and getting them help if they’re not […]